RHSA-2025:11426 - Moderate: python-setuptools security update


Synopsis

Moderate: python-setuptools security update

Type/Severity

Security Advisory Moderate

Topic

An update for python-setuptools is now available for Red Hat Enterprise Linux 8.2 Advanced Update Support.

Red Hat Product Security has rated this update as having a security impact of Moderate. A Common Vulnerability Scoring System (CVSS) base score, which gives a detailed severity rating, is available for each vulnerability from the CVE link(s) in the References section.

Description

Python is an interpreted, interactive, object-oriented programming language, which includes modules, classes, exceptions, very high level dynamic data types and dynamic typing. Python supports interfaces to many system calls and libraries, as well as to various windowing systems.

Security Fix(es):

  • setuptools: Path Traversal Vulnerability in setuptools PackageIndex (CVE-2025-47273)
